
NSCSA-The National Shipping Company of Saudi Arabia
NSCSA The National Shipping Company of Saudi Arabia is a multipurpose shipping provider with a long-standing history in Ro-Ro, container, and break-bulk operations. Established in 1979, NSCSA was created to meet the transportation needs of importers and exporters in the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ia and the broader Middle East. By 1983, the company had evolved into a substantial operator with eight fully owned vessels, combining Ro-Ro, container, and break-bulk capabilities to serve a diverse range of trade lanes. Over the years, NSCSA positioned itself as one of the world’s larger Ro-Ro operators, developing liner services that linked the Middle East with North America and supporting complex cargo movements across multiple regions.
NSCSA’s fleet profile includes multipurpose vessels capable of handling containers, Ro-Ro cargoes, and break-bulk shipments. This versatility enables the company to manage a wide array of cargo types, from standard containerized goods to specialized project and heavy-lift consignments. The carrier has undertaken project-related activities such as transporting boilers, transformers, and various heavy equipment, underscoring its capability to manage heavy lift and project cargo combined with conventional liner services.
In terms of routes and connectivity, NSCSA has historically maintained operations across key corridors that include Mumbai, Jeddah, Livorno, and select U.S. ports such as New York and Baltimore for westbound voyages, along with U.S. ports including Houston, Savannah, Wilmington, and others in North America. The network also features feeder-like movements to and through Jeddah, Dubai, Dammam, and Mumbai, reflecting an integrated approach to maritime logistics across the Middle East, Europe, and North America.
